Job summary

Rural Psychiatry Associates in Anchorage, AK is seeking a Patient Registration Coordinator to join our team. You will be the first point of contact for patients, assisting with registration, scheduling, and insurance documentation in a fast-paced clinical setting.

The role requires strong communication, attention to detail, and proficiency with electronic health records. You will work with clinicians and admin staff to ensure smooth patient access and HIPAA compliant processes.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Experience in scheduling appointments in a healthcare setting preferred.
  • Excellent communication skills, verbal and written.
  • Strong attention to detail and multitasking in a fast-paced environment.
  • Proficiency with electronic health record (EHR) systems and general computer skills.
  • Ability to maintain patient confidentiality and HIPAA compliance.
  • Highly organized, self-motivated, and able to work independently.

Responsibilities

  • Greet and assist patients and visitors, providing a welcoming first impression.
  • Collect and verify patient information, ensuring accuracy of personal, medical, and insurance details.
  • Coordinate appointments: schedule, confirm, and provide reminders for patient visits.
  • Support telehealth services by educating patients and providing technical assistance as needed.
  • Maintain patient confidentiality and adhere to HIPAA regulations.
  • Provide general administrative support and complete necessary forms and documentation.
  • Perform other duties as assigned to support clinic operations.
